con il !empty a me piace di piu' e il codice appare piu' ordinato, pero' dipende anche da caso a caso come deve essere considerato lo zero..... infatti una stringa contenente solo il numero "0" per la funzione empty è vuota....
In pratica io uso sempre empty tranne quando lo zero voglio considerarlo come stringa non vuota..
![]()